Output 21354e79fc90668e6e336f1ca3b6195e854c40e666d27c5e28b9fa7042bddaa9:1

value
995171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04a1b2f4d546c315f6e841f18dd7897d347b40f2 OP_EQUAL
address
327WLMiHw7zyuigFqpunZ7CJL8FhDNGsdA
transaction
21354e79fc90668e6e336f1ca3b6195e854c40e666d27c5e28b9fa7042bddaa9
spent
true